I have a very odd bug happening.

When a mission is hosted locally (singleplayer) ACLS works perfectly as intended, but when the same mission is hosted on a dedicated multiplayer server the ACLS "DATA" never gets transmitted to the aircraft.

EX: Singleplayer local host, feature works as intended.

       Multiplayer Dedicated Server Host, in the F/A-18C the "DATA" popup on the HUD never occurs so the ACLS CPL cannot be used.

 

 

When doing some digging and troubleshooting (I spent ~6hours on this so far) I found that in the multiplayer dedicated server the kneeboard for the Link4 appeared different than in the singleplayer local host and this might be the cause of the issue. (Keep in mind this is the same mission file, just different hosting methods)

 

Singleplayer Local host (working as intended):

Here we can see the name of the carriers in the quotation marks

j9U3nAH.png

 

 

.

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

Multiplayer Dedicated Server host (Not working, no "DATA" appears in the HUD) :

Here there is no name for the carriers in the quotation marks.

z8d0GXk.png

 

 

 

 

 

.

 

 

 

 

 

.

 

This is the ONLY difference I can spot between the two hosting methods and might be causing the bug.

(again, it is the same exact .miz; just run 2 different ways)
